AddSvg

ShapeCollection.AddSvg method

Agrega imagen svg.

public Picture AddSvg(int upperLeftRow, int top, int upperLeftColumn, int left, int height, 
    int width, byte[] svgData, byte[] compatibleImageData)
ParámetroEscribeDescripción
upperLeftRowInt32Índice de la fila superior izquierda.
topInt32Representa el desplazamiento vertical de la forma desde su fila izquierda, en unidades de píxel.
upperLeftColumnInt32Índice de la columna superior izquierda.
leftInt32El desplazamiento horizontal de la forma desde su columna izquierda, en unidades de píxel.
heightInt32La altura de la forma, en unidades de píxel.
widthInt32El ancho de la forma, en unidades de píxel.
svgDataByte[]Los datos de la imagen svg.
compatibleImageDataByte[]Datos de imagen convertidos de svg para que sean compatibles con Excel 2016 o versiones inferiores.

Ejemplos


[C#]
// agregar un svg
using (FileStream fs = new FileStream("image.svg", FileMode.Open))
{
    int len = (int)fs.Length;
    byte[] imageData = new byte[len];
    fs.Read(imageData, 0, len);
    Picture picture = shapes.AddSvg(4, 0, 5, 0, -1, -1, imageData, null);
}

Ver también